Battery life is one of the primary deciding factors when buying a laptop for productivity. You’ll certainly want the longest time off the vicinity of a power socket for as long as possible. At IFA 2018, ASUS announced a premium notebook that addresses just that. Welcome the ASUS ZenBook S with a staggering 20-hour battery life.
Powered by an Intel Core i7-8550U processor, and 8GB of LPDDR3 RAM, the ZenBook S offers military-grade durability, and the absolute level of performance and portability that users on-the-go need.

Specifications
Model | UX391UA-EG020T |
UX391UA-ET082T | |
UX391UA-ET088T | |
OS | Windows 10 (64-Bit) |
Processor | Intel Core i5-8250U |
Intel Core i7-8550U | |
RAM | 8GB LPDDR3 |
Storage | SATA3 256GB M.2 SSD |
Graphics | Intel UHD Graphics 620 |
Display | 13.3" Ultra Slim FHD, Anti-Glare |
Ports | 1 x USB 3.1 Type-C (Gen 1) |
2 x USB 3.1 Type-C (Gen 2) with Thunderbolt | |
1 x Combo Jack | |
Keyboard | Illuminated Chiclet Keyboard |
Battery | 50WHrs, 2S2P, 4-cell Li-ion |
Dimensions | 31.1(W) x 21.3(D) x 1.29 ~ 1.29 (H) cm |
Weight (w/ Battery) | 1.0 kg/ 1.05 kg |
